Graphic Designer Full Description

Overview: 
The Graphic Designer develops visual designs to support a variety of projects for Penn College, including publications, advertisements, digital graphics, and promotional materials. This role works within established brand standards to create clear and engaging materials. This position collaborates with members of the creative, marketing, and communications teams to prepare and deliver high-quality, approved assets for print and digital distribution, working under established processes and creative direction and within project timelines.

Responsibilities: 
Create artwork and full layouts for web, digital, print, environmental graphics, and promotional materials.
Provide creative input as part of the team for the College’s marketing and PR campaigns.
Collaborate with clients and project leads throughout the design process to ensure accuracy and to support successful project completion.
Work with the MARCOM team to create materials reflecting client and institutional goals.
Align designs with the College’s brand strategy and style guide.
Make design decisions within established direction and brand standards.
Select brand-appropriate colors, paper, typography, and design formats in accordance with brand guidelines.
Review, edit, proofread, and critique content for accuracy and brand consistency.
Maintain awareness of assigned project timelines and deliverables to ensure on-time completion of work. Prepare production-ready files for print and digital distribution.
Develop and distribute accurate proofs that meet project requirements.
Ensure completed projects meet goals efficiently, utilizing available resources.
Design issues of the College’s magazine in collaboration with senior designers and editors.
Attend photo shoots to support creative direction provided by project leads.
Attend campus events as assigned to support future project needs.
Provide design support for materials produced by other departments.
Offer guidance on visual standards when requested.
Provide approved College logos and images following brand procedures.
Consult with specialists and vendors to ensure quality production in coordination with project leads.
Use MARCOM’s photography database for photo selections following standard procedures.
Use MARCOM’s scheduling database to record and track project status for assigned projects.
